Design and Build Quality

The DJI Inspire 3 boasts a sleek, modular design optimized for ease of transport and rapid deployment. Its carbon fiber construction ensures durability while maintaining a lightweight profile. The Yuneec H520E features a robust hexacopter frame, built for stability and resilience in challenging environments. Its industrial-grade construction emphasizes durability over portability, making it suitable for demanding professional tasks.

Flight Performance and Stability

The Inspire 3 offers exceptional flight stability, thanks to advanced gimbal and flight control systems. It supports a maximum flight time of approximately 28 minutes under optimal conditions. The Yuneec H520E provides reliable stability with six rotors, which enhances safety and redundancy. Its flight time is around 25 minutes, suitable for extended missions where reliability is critical.

Camera Capabilities

The Inspire 3 is equipped with a Zenmuse X9 camera system, supporting up to 8K video recording and interchangeable lenses. Its gimbal stabilization ensures smooth footage even in windy conditions. The Yuneec H520E features a high-resolution camera capable of 4K video and high-quality still images. While it may lack some of the advanced lens options of the Inspire 3, it provides excellent image quality for professional applications.

Intelligence and Navigation

The Inspire 3 incorporates DJI’s latest flight intelligence features, including obstacle avoidance, precise GPS positioning, and autonomous flight modes. It supports complex flight paths with high accuracy. The Yuneec H520E also offers obstacle detection and avoidance, along with multiple autonomous flight modes, making it suitable for complex surveying and inspection tasks.
